The number of photons emitted by a monochromatic (single frequency) infrared range finder of power \( 1 \mathrm{~mW} \) and wavelength of \( 1000 \mathrm{~nm} \), in 0.1 second is \( x \times 10^{13} \). The value of \( \mathrm{x} \) is
\[
\left(\mathrm{h}=6.63 \times 10^{-34} \mathrm{Js}, \mathrm{c}=3.00 \times 10^{8} \mathrm{~ms}^{-1}\right)
\]
